I had found this quote from St. Pius X and thought it was an appropriate comment for our times. I also thought that it beautiful reflection in honor of Our Lady of the Immaculate Conception, patroness of the United States of America.
"Truly we are passing through disastrous times, when we may well make our own the lamentation of the Prophet: "There is no truth, and there is no mercy, and there is no knowledge of God in the land" (Osee 4. 1). Yet in the midst of this tide of evil, the Virgin Most Merciful rises before our eyes like a rainbow, as the arbiter of peace between God and man."
- St. Pius X
